1. The writer wrote that Microsoft "...has a firm grip on the handheld software market..." It doesn't say anywhere that Microsoft itself ships handhelds.
2. There is no "Palm" anymore. Palm Inc. has since become palmOne and PalmSource. PalmSource is the company responsible for the Palm OS, and palmOne is responsible for the handhelds.
